支架式
  zi1 gaa3*2 sik1   jyutping
[yoga] Chaturanga Dandasana, Four Limbs Stick


Level: 5
This term is used in both Cantonese and Mandarin/Standard written Chinese.

Characters in this word:

 zi1  -  prop up; sustain; protrude; pay (money)
 gaa3 gaa2  -  erect; put up; fight; quarrel; frame; rack
 sik1  -  type; style; standards; ceremony

2 compounds containing this word:

後仰支架式 - [yoga] Purvottanasana, Inclined Plane
斜支架式 - [yoga] Vasisthasana, Side Plank
